Re: My first problem with FSP. Ever. - SE-TMA - 19-11-2005

This, I think, have been discussed before. But, anyhow, it is because of anti-aliasing settings. It kills FPS a bit, but reset anti-aliasing control
to FS, or disable it all togheter. This solves the "cutout" error with windowed mode and double screens.




Re: My first problem with FSP. Ever. - Ionathan - 22-11-2005

Also, if you are using Nvidia you may have problems due to old drivers. I have NV6600GT and have some problems. Download the latest
drivers and it will help, at least when running in maximized window. In full screen I am afraid the problem remains.
